1. PARKING

Find a level, clean, and safe spot. Ensure the trailer is positioned correctly to avoid damage during the return process.

2. DISCONNECT

Disconnect the electrical connector and brake controller. Verify all connections are secure and the hitch is properly released.

3. SECURE

Lock the trailer doors / gate and secure all equipment. Ensure the hitch is properly secured and the tires are clean and dry.

4. SUBMIT

Take clear photos of the trailer and submit them with your return form. We'll verify the condition and process your deposit.
